Alexa Icon - Dot Emoji,Alexa Logo

Alexa Icon - Dot Emoji,Alexa Logo
Resolution: 395 x 397
Downloads: 0
Views: 102
Likes: 0
Size: 24.89 KB
Upload Time: 2021-03-28 07:45:33
License: Free for personal and commercial purpose with attribution